> James Thomas via "Bug reports for GNU Emacs, the Swiss army knife of
> text editors" <bug-gnu-emacs@gnu.org> writes:
> 
> > - (Preferably starting with an empty drafts folder) Compose a message
> >   and save it.
> > - Open the drafts group, press e on the message and then kill the new
> >   buffer; then (incidentally, if you now do '/ N' then this bug does not
> >   arise) delete the message (B DEL)
> > - Press q
> > - The message count is wrong (but can be corrected with M-g)
> >
> > cf. In gnus.general (gnus-summary-goto-article "87y192lr8f.fsf@gmx.net")
